It would be much easier (and cheaper) to swap a C5 / D2 / D3 V8 engine into your B5, than trying to make a B6 S4 a B5.
If you pick up a D2 A8 v8 engine, you’ll still need to use a C5 A6 4.2 wiring harness. And if you go with a D3 V8, you’ll need to use an S6 harness and ECU.
It's possible to remove the old discs with the carrier in situ, only if the discs are worn really thin. But, you will not get the new ones on, they'll be too thick.
If the carrier bolts are worn (internal 8/10mm hex?) I would bash on an appropriate 12-point socket, and remove them that way.
There are 6-speed 01E FWD manual gearboxes, that will work just fine, from the following models:
C4 100 / A6 2.5 V6 TDI FWD.
C5 A6 2.5 V6 TDI FWD.
Use a B5 S4 / 2.5 V6 TDI Quattro shifter, and its mounts, with any B5 quattro subframe, and that's it.
